Transaction 26c5985450f63912de4144c9efc001586850f74a75e2db17cdf10f48345aef1e
1 Input
1 Output
-
26c5985450f63912de4144c9efc001586850f74a75e2db17cdf10f48345aef1e:0
- value
- 1442626
- script pubkey
- OP_0 OP_PUSHBYTES_20 83e4942feb9eabceb86aef90cf4646a3db84380d
- address
- bc1qs0jfgtltn64uawr2a7gv73jx50dcgwqd60x3ha